Casting is often an underappreciated aspect of filmmaking, but it plays a vital role in shaping the final product. A good casting director can identify actors who not only fit the physical description of a character but also bring depth and nuance to the role. The era in which Susan Ayn was most active saw significant shifts in how casting agencies treated talent. Historically, European casting pipelines faced criticism regarding transparency. However, increased digital oversight, decentralized performer platforms (like OnlyFans), and stronger advocacy groups have transformed how talent is scouted today. Modern performers use casting as a collaborative negotiation rather than a strict gatekeeping process, ensuring greater control over their imagery, digital rights, and physical safety.
